The Phoenix Contact Crimp Contact has been meticulously designed for superior performance in a wide range of applications. The crimp contact boasts a sophisticated construction, ensuring optimal connectivity with a contact diameter of 1 mm. Built from robust materials, it offers exceptional durability while maintaining a compact profile, making it an ideal choice for both industrial and commercial environments. The product meets stringent RoHS II regulations, ensuring it is environmentally friendly without compromising on reliability.
Provides a strong vibration resistant connection to ensure stability
Complies with RoHS II regulations for environmentally conscious use
Offers low contact resistance for efficient electrical performance
Supports a versatile conductor cross section for diverse applications
Engineered to handle up to 100 insertion/withdrawal cycles without degradation
